Skip to main content

Utilisation de GitHub Copilot avec un compte sur GHE.com

Mettez à jour votre environnement de développement pour accéder à un Copilot plan pour un compte sur GHE.com.

Pour utiliser GitHub Copilot dans un IDE ou sur la ligne de commande, vous devez vous authentifier sur un compte de GitHub auquel une licence Copilot est associée.

Si vous recevez l'accès à Copilot via une compte d’utilisateur managé appartenant à une entreprise sur GHE.com, vous devrez peut-être ajuster certains paramètres dans votre IDE avant de pouvoir vous authentifier à votre compte.

Utilisez les onglets en haut de cet article pour consulter les instructions relatives à votre environnement.

Authentification à partir de VS Code

  1. Pour ouvrir vos VS Code paramètres, appuyez sur Commande+, (Mac) ou Ctrl+(Windows).

  2. Dans la barre de recherche, recherchez enterprise.

  3. Pour le réglage Github-enterprise: Uri, entrez l'URL à laquelle vous accédez GitHub. Par exemple : https://octocorp.ghe.com.

  4. Dans les VS Code paramètres, recherchez copilot.

  5. Sous « GitHub > Copilot : Avancé », cliquez sur Edit dans settings.json.

  6. Dans la propriété github.copilot.advanced, ajoutez "authProvider": "github-enterprise". Par exemple :

    JSON
    "github.copilot.advanced": {
         "authProvider": "github-enterprise"
    },
    
  7. Enregistrez le fichier settings.json.

  8. Vous serez invité à vous connecter pour utiliser GitHub Copilot. Cliquez sur Se connecter à GitHub, puis suivez les invites pour autoriser votre compte.

    Si vous ne voyez pas l’invite, VS Codeessayez de redémarrer.

Si vous avez besoin de passer à un compte sur GitHub.com, supprimez le paramètre authProvider de settings.json.

S’authentifier à partir des IDE JetBrains

Pour vous authentifier sur GHE.com dans un éditeur JetBrains, vous devez installer la version 1.4.11 ou ultérieure de l’extension Copilot. Vous devez ensuite configurer l’extension pour qu’elle fonctionne avec GHE.com.

  1. Pour ouvrir la boîte de dialogue des préférences ou des paramètres de l’éditeur, appuyez sur Commande+, (Mac) ou Ctrl+Alt+S (Windows).
  2. Dans la barre latérale gauche, développez la section « Outils », puis cliquez sur GitHub Copilot.
  3. Dans la section « Général », recherchez le champ « Fournisseur d’authentification » et entrez le nom d’hôte auquel vous accédez GitHub. Par exemple : octocorp.ghe.com.
  4. Pour enregistrer vos modifications, cliquez sur OK.
  5. Suivez les invites pour vous connecter et utiliser GitHub Copilot.

Pour vous connecter et vous déconnecter GitHub à tout moment, cliquez sur l’icône Tchat Copilot () dans la barre d’état, puis sur Se connecter à GitHub. Suivez les invites pour vous connecter.

Si vous avez besoin de basculer vers un compte sur GitHub.com, supprimez la valeur que vous avez entrée dans le champ « Fournisseur d’authentification ».

S’authentifier à partir de Xcode

  1. Ouvrez l’application «GitHub Copilot for Xcode ».
  2. Cliquez sur l’onglet Avancé.
  3. Dans le champ « URL du fournisseur d’authentification », entrez l’URL à laquelle vous accédez GitHub. Par exemple : https://octocorp.ghe.com.
  4. Autorisez l’extension en suivant les instructions indiquées dans la section Connexion à GitHub Copilot.

S’authentifier à partir de la ligne de commande

Pour utiliser Copilot CLI, vous devez :

  1. Téléchargez et installez Copilot CLI. Consultez Installation de GitHub Copilot CLI.
  2. Authentifiez-vous sur le compte GHE.com, où vous recevez votre licence Copilot avec copilot login --host SUBDOMAIN.ghe.com.

Pour obtenir des informations générales sur l’utilisation Copilot CLI, consultez CLI de GitHub Copilot.

Authentification à partir de Visual Studio

Pour vous authentifier à partir de Visual Studio, suivez les étapes décrites dans Addez vos comptes GitHub à votre trousseau Visual Studio sur Microsoft Learn.

Pour le champ «GitHub Enterprise URL », entrez l’URL à laquelle vous accédez GitHub. Par exemple : https://octocorp.ghe.com.

Authentification à partir d’Eclipse

  1. Dans l’IDE, cliquez Copilot pour ouvrir le menu.
  2. Cliquez sur Modifier les préférences....
  3. Dans le GitHub Enterprise champ Point de terminaison d’authentification , entrez l’URL à laquelle vous accédez GitHub. Par exemple : https://octocorp.ghe.com.
  4. Cliquez sur Appliquer.
  5. Ouvrez à nouveau le Copilot menu, puis cliquez sur Se connecter à GitHub.